Dan York, 70, passed away Wednesday, September 16, 1964, at the Scott County Hospital after a lingering illness. He was a lifelong resident of Scott County and a member of the Bethlehem Baptist Church, a veteran of World War I, and a member of American Legion Post No. 136.

He is survived by his wife, Mrs. Ella Newport York of Oneida, Tennessee; 4 brothers, John York, Riley York and Joe York all of Clinton, Tennessee, Silas York of Route 2, Pioneer, Tennessee.

American Legion Post No. 136 served as pallbearers and World War I veterans served as honorary pallbearers. Funeral services were conducted 2 p.m. Friday, September 18, 1964, from the Bethlehem Baptist Church with Revs. Roy Blevins and Virgil Cecil officiating. Interment followed in the Hazel Valley Cemetery. West in charge.

(Source: Scott County News, 25 Sep 1964, p1)
